在现代软件开发中,代码审查是一项至关重要的实践,能够有效提升代码质量、减少错误并促进团队之间的知识共享。谷歌浏览器(Google Chrome)因其强大的开发者工具(DevTools)而成为进行代码审查的重要平台。本文将介绍如何在谷歌浏览器中使用开发者工具进行代码审查的步骤和技巧。
一、打开开发者工具
在谷歌浏览器中,打开任何网页后,你可以通过以下方式快速启动开发者工具:
1. 右键点击网页中的任意位置,选择“检查”(Inspect)。
2. 使用快捷键:Windows系统中按`Ctrl + Shift + I`,而在macOS上则是`Command + Option + I`。
3. 在浏览器右上角的菜单中选择“更多工具”(More Tools)>“开发者工具”(Developer Tools)。
二、审查HTML结构
一旦打开开发者工具,默认情况下会看到“元素”标签页,这是审查网页HTML的主要区域。在这里,你可以看到网页的DOM结构。
- 鼠标悬停在不同的HTML元素上,可以在页面上高亮显示其对应的位置。
- 右键点击任何元素,可以进行“编辑为HTML”或“复制”操作,方便进一步分析和修改。
- 利用此功能,团队可以审查元素的结构、嵌套关系以及CSS样式,从而确保按预期展示。
三、审查CSS样式
在“元素”标签页中,右侧通常会显示对应元素的样式面板。在这里,可以看到每个元素应用的CSS样式,并能进行实时修改。
- 通过勾选或取消勾选样式属性,可以快速检查不同样式变化对页面的影响。
- 页面样式修改后,即时反应在页面上,易于测试不同的排版和颜色方案。
四、调试JavaScript代码
在开发者工具中,JavaScript的调试是代码审查的重要环节。
1. 转到“源代码”标签页(Sources),可以看到加载的JavaScript文件。
2. 通过设置断点,可以在特定的代码行暂停执行,从而逐步检查变量的值、函数的执行过程等。
3. 使用控制台(Console),可以执行JavaScript代码,进行小范围的测试,同时查看警告和错误信息,帮助快速定位问题。
五、网络请求监控
通过“网络”标签页(Network),你可以监控页面的所有网络请求,包括API调用、资源加载等。这对代码审查尤其重要,因为很多网页功能依赖于与服务器的沟通。
- 在此页面上可以查看请求的状态码、响应时间和返回数据,从而确认API接口的有效性以及性能。
- 如果加载速度过慢,或某些资源未成功加载,这些信息能帮助开发者优化并提升用户体验。
六、性能分析
谷歌浏览器的“性能”标签页为开发者提供了一套工具,可以帮助分析页面在不同操作下的性能。这对代码审查有重要意义,因为性能问题往往与代码的优化程度密切相关。
- 点击“记录”按钮,进行一次交互操作,然后停止记录。此时会生成一份性能报告,详细展示页面在这一段时间内的资源使用情况。
- 通过分析前端的性能瓶颈,开发者可以优化代码、减少不必要的DOM操作,实现更快的页面响应。
结论
通过上述步骤,开发团队可以高效地在谷歌浏览器中进行代码审查。利用开发者工具,开发人员不仅能审查HTML、CSS和JavaScript代码,还能监控网络请求和分析性能,从而确保代码的高质量与良好用户体验。持续优化代码审查流程,将使团队在面对快速发展的技术环境时,具备更强的适应能力和竞争优势。